• 0 Is Green Tea Really Good for Everyone? Exploring the Pros and Cons

    Green tea has long been touted as a health elixir, praised for its numerous benefits ranging from weight loss aid to cancer prevention. However, while green tea offers a plethora of advantages, its suitability for everyone is a subject of debate. Let's delve into the pros and cons to determine if green tea is truly beneficial for everyone. The Pros of Green Tea: Rich in Antioxidants: Green tea is packed with antioxidants, particularly catechins, which help combat oxidative stress and reduce the risk of chronic diseases like heart disease and cancer. Boosts Metabolism: The catechins in green tea can increase fat burning and boost metabolic rate, aiding in weight loss and fat reduction. Improves Brain Function: The caffeine and amino acid L-theanine in green tea work synergistically to enhance brain function, improving mood, focus, and cognitive performance. Promotes Heart Health: Regular consumption of green tea has been linked to lower levels of LDL cholesterol, reduced blood pressure, and improved overall heart health. May Lower Risk of Type 2 Diabetes: Some studies suggest that green tea may help regulate blood sugar levels and improve insulin sensitivity, reducing the risk of type 2 diabetes. The Cons of Green Tea: Caffeine Sensitivity: Green tea contains caffeine, which can cause insomnia, jitteriness, and anxiety in individuals sensitive to caffeine. Stomach Upset: Excessive consumption of green tea may lead to stomach upset, nausea, or even digestive issues like acid reflux or irritable bowel syndrome (IBS) in some people. Interference with Iron Absorption: Green tea contains compounds that can inhibit the absorption of iron from plant-based sources, potentially leading to iron deficiency anemia, especially in individuals with low iron stores. Potential for Medication Interactions: The catechins in green tea may interact with certain medications, affecting their efficacy or increasing the risk of side effects. It's crucial to consult a healthcare provider before consuming green tea regularly, especially if taking medication. Risk of Overconsumption: While moderate consumption of green tea is generally safe, excessive intake can lead to caffeine overdose or toxicity, resulting in adverse effects like rapid heart rate, dizziness, or even cardiac arrhythmias.   While green tea offers numerous health benefits, it may not be suitable for everyone. Individuals sensitive to caffeine, prone to stomach issues, or at risk of iron deficiency should exercise caution when consuming green tea. Additionally, those taking medications should consult a healthcare professional to avoid potential interactions. Ultimately, moderation is key, and incorporating green tea into a balanced diet and healthy lifestyle can reap its rewards while minimizing risks.

  • 0 Exploring Dumping Syndrome After Gastric Sleeve Surgery

    Gastric sleeve surgery, also known as sleeve gastrectomy, is a popular choice for weight loss among individuals dealing with obesity. While it offers significant benefits in terms of weight reduction and improved metabolic health, understanding and managing potential post-operative complications are crucial. One such complication is dumping syndrome, which can significantly impact a patient’s well-being and requires careful attention. In this discussion, we delve into the details of dumping syndrome following gastric sleeve surgery, examining its origins, symptoms, diagnosis, and treatment options. Understanding Dumping Syndrome: Dumping syndrome occurs when food, especially sugars, rapidly moves from the stomach to the small intestine. This rapid emptying triggers a series of physiological reactions, resulting in various distressing symptoms for patients. Dumping syndrome is categorized into two types: Early dumping syndrome: Occurs within 30 minutes after a meal. Late dumping syndrome: Typically manifests 1 to 3 hours after eating. Identifying Causes and Risk Factors: The development of dumping syndrome after gastric sleeve surgery involves multiple factors. Key contributors include: Altered stomach anatomy: The modified stomach shape leads to faster food transit into the small intestine. Hormonal changes: Elevated gut hormones like glucagon-like peptide-1 (GLP-1) and peptide YY (PYY) affect gastric emptying and insulin secretion. Dietary choices: Consuming high-carbohydrate or high-sugar diets can worsen dumping syndrome symptoms. Understanding Dumping Syndrome After Gastric Sleeve Surgery Dumping syndrome can occur after gastric sleeve surgery, affecting patients in various ways. Let’s explore its symptoms, diagnostic approaches, and treatment strategies: Symptoms: Early Dumping Syndrome: Within 30 minutes after a meal, patients may experience: Nausea Vomiting Abdominal cramps Diarrhea Dizziness Perspiration Palpitations Late Dumping Syndrome: Typically 1 to 3 hours after eating, symptoms include: Weakness Perspiration Confusion Palpitations (often associated with hypoglycemia) Diagnosis: Physicians consider the patient’s medical history, symptoms, and dietary habits. Diagnostic tests may include gastric emptying studies, glucose tolerance tests, and blood glucose monitoring. Differentiating between early and late dumping syndrome is crucial. Treatment Strategies: Dietary Adjustments: Opt for smaller, frequent meals. Avoid foods high in sugars and simple carbohydrates. Increase dietary fiber intake to slow gastric emptying and stabilize blood sugar levels. Conclusion: Dumping syndrome presents challenges but can be managed effectively. Healthcare professionals play a vital role in educating patients, guiding dietary modifications, and providing ongoing support. Awareness empowers patients on their weight loss journey.   • 0 Embracing the Future of Dentistry: A Guide to Metal-Free Dental Implants

    Dental technology has evolved, offering patients more choices for tooth restoration. Among these innovations, metal-free dental implants have gained popularity for their biocompatibility and aesthetic appeal. This article explores the key aspects of metal-free dental implants, helping you understand if they are the right choice for your oral health journey. What are Metal-Free Dental Implants? Metal-free dental implants, often made from zirconia, are a revolutionary alternative to traditional titanium implants. These implants provide a strong foundation for tooth restoration without the use of metal components. They are biocompatible, ensuring a seamless integration with the jawbone. Metal-Free or Ceramic Dental Implants: The materials used in metal-free or ceramic dental implants, such as zirconia, offer a natural-looking and tooth-coloured alternative to traditional titanium. This aesthetic advantage makes them a preferred choice for those seeking a restoration that seamlessly blends with their natural teeth. Who Should Consider Zirconia or Ceramic Dental Implants? Individuals with metal sensitivities or allergies may find zirconia or ceramic dental implants to be a suitable option. Additionally, for those who prioritize aesthetic concerns, the tooth-coloured nature of these implants makes them an excellent choice. How Can I Tell If I Have an Allergy to Dental Metal? If you suspect a metal allergy, a MELISA test can be conducted. This blood test measures sensitivities to various metals, including titanium. Although rare, having a sensitivity towards titanium is possible. If confirmed, opting for metal-free dental implants may be a more suitable and comfortable choice. Ceramic or Metal-Free Crowns and Bridges: Once you've chosen metal-free dental implants, the restoration process involves crowns or bridges made from zirconia. These restorations not only provide excellent aesthetic results but also function like natural teeth, ensuring a harmonious blend with your smile. Caring for Metal-Free Dental Implants: Caring for metal-free dental implants is straightforward. Regular oral hygiene practices, including thorough cleaning around the implants, are essential. Professional dental checkups and cleanings ensure the longevity and optimal health of your metal-free dental implants.   Metal-free dental implants, particularly those made from zirconia, represent a significant advancement in dental care. Whether you have metal sensitivities, aesthetic preferences, or a desire for a biocompatible solution, metal-free dental implants offer a compelling choice. Consult with your dentist to determine if these innovative implants align with your unique oral health needs.

    In the realm of assisted reproductive technologies, Preimplantation Genetic Diagnosis (PGD) has emerged as a groundbreaking tool, propelling In Vitro Fertilization (IVF) into the future. This innovative procedure allows prospective parents to delve into the genetic makeup of embryos, paving the way for the selection of embryos with optimal health and reduced risk of genetic disorders. In this article, we explore how PGD is reshaping the landscape of IVF and contributing to the design of what some may call "futuristic super babies."   Understanding PGD: Preimplantation Genetic Diagnosis is a sophisticated technique employed during IVF to assess embryos for genetic abnormalities before implantation. Typically performed at the blastocyst stage, around day 5 or 6 of development, PGD involves the biopsy of a few cells from embryos. These cells undergo meticulous genetic analysis, allowing for the identification of specific genetic mutations or chromosomal disorders.   Benefits of PGD in IVF: 1. Precision in Embryo Selection:    PGD empowers prospective parents to make informed decisions about which embryos to implant. By identifying and selecting embryos without genetic abnormalities, the chances of a successful pregnancy and the birth of a healthy child are significantly increased.   2. Reducing Genetic Risks:    Couples with a known family history of genetic disorders or those who are carriers of genetic mutations can benefit immensely from PGD. This technology provides a proactive approach to family planning, helping to mitigate the risk of passing on hereditary conditions to future generations.   3. Enhancing IVF Success Rates:    The careful screening offered by PGD contributes to higher success rates in IVF procedures. By choosing embryos with optimal genetic health, healthcare providers can improve the likelihood of successful implantation and a healthy pregnancy.   Some examples of single gene disorders that can be diagnosed through Preimplantation Genetic Diagnosis include; - Achondroplasia – Adrenoleukodystrophy – Agammaglobulinemia - Alpha-1-Antitrypsin - Alpha Thalassemia - Alport Syndrome - Alzheimer's disease - Early onset (PSEN1-2) - Becker Muscular Dystrophy - Beta Thalassemia - Charcot Marie Tooth- Cystic Fibrosis - Crouzon Syndrome - Duchenne Muscular Dystrophy – Dystonia - Epidermolysis Bullosa - Fanconi Anemia - Familial adenomatous polyposis (FAP) - Familial dysautonomia - Fragile-X Syndrome - Gaucher's Disease - Glycogen Storage Disease - Hemophilia A and B - HLA tissue typing - HSNF5 mutations - Huntington's disease - Hurler Syndrome  - Incontinentia pigment - Kell disease - Lesch Nyhan Syndrome  - Long Chain Acyl-CoA Dehydrogenase (LCHAD) deficiency - Marfan Syndrome - MELAS - Multiple Endocrine Neoplasia Type II (MEN II) - Multiple Epiphyseal Dysplasia - Myotonic Dystrophy - Myotubular Myopathy - Neurofibromatosis type I &type II - Norrie disease- Osteogenesis imperfecta I – IV - OTC Deficiency - P53 - Phenylketonuria - Autosomal Dominant Polycystic Kidney Disease (Type I and II) - Retinitis Pigmentosa - SCA 6 - Sickle Cell Anemia - Sonic Hedgehog mutations - Spinal/Bulbar Muscular Atrophy - Spinal Muscular Atrophy - Tay-Sachs Disease - Translocations by FISH - Tuberous sclerosis - Von Hippel Lindau - Wiskott-Aldrich Syndrome - X-linked hydrocephalus - X-linked hyper IgM syndrome   Ethical Considerations: While the potential of PGD in shaping the genetic destiny of offspring is undeniable, ethical considerations surround its use. The power to select certain genetic traits raises questions about the ethical boundaries of genetic engineering and the potential societal implications of creating "designer babies." The decision to undergo PGD is deeply personal, and ethical concerns should be addressed through open conversations with healthcare professionals and genetic counsellors.   As we navigate the future of reproductive medicine, PGD stands at the forefront, offering a glimpse into the potential for designing healthier generations. The ability to select embryos with optimal genetic health represents a transformative step in IVF, providing hope for prospective parents and contributing to the evolving landscape of assisted reproductive technologies.   • 0 How to Care for Your Scars After Plastic Surgery

    Plastic surgery can improve your appearance and boost your confidence, but it can also leave some scars on your skin. While some scars may fade over time, others may remain visible and affect your self-esteem. Fortunately, there are some ways to care for your scars after plastic surgery and make them lighter or even invisible. Here are some tips to follow: Use Scar Creams or Gels One of the most effective ways to reduce the appearance of scars is to apply scar creams or gels regularly. These products contain ingredients that can help heal the skin, reduce inflammation, and stimulate collagen production. Some of the most popular scar creams or gels are Scarex Gel, Contractubex Gel, and Mederma Gel. You can find them in pharmacies or online. Follow the instructions on the package and apply them twice a day for at least three months. Protect Your Skin from the Sun Another important step to care for your scars is to protect your skin from the sun. Sun exposure can darken your scars and make them more noticeable. It can also damage your skin and slow down the healing process. Therefore, you should always wear sunscreen with at least SPF 30 and cover your scars with clothing or hats when you go outside. Avoid tanning beds and sun lamps as well. Use St. John’s Wort Oil St. John’s Wort oil is a natural remedy that can help improve the appearance of scars. It has anti-inflammatory, antibacterial, and antioxidant properties that can soothe the skin and prevent infections. It can also stimulate blood circulation and promote skin regeneration. You can buy St. John’s Wort oil in health food stores or online. Massage a few drops of the oil on your scars twice a week for at least six weeks. Follow Your Surgeon’s Instructions Finally, the best way to care for your scars is to follow your surgeon’s instructions. Your surgeon will give you specific advice on how to clean, dress, and treat your wounds after the surgery. You should also avoid smoking, drinking alcohol, and taking certain medications that can interfere with the healing process. You should also attend your follow-up appointments and report any signs of infection, bleeding, or abnormal pain. Your surgeon may also recommend some other treatments such as silicone sheets, steroid injections, or laser therapy to improve your scars.   Scars are a common side effect of plastic surgery, but they don’t have to ruin your results. By following these tips, you can care for your scars and make them less visible. Remember that scars take time to heal and improve, so be patient and consistent with your scar care routine. With proper care, you can enjoy your new look and feel confident in your skin.

Experience a breakthrough in hair restoration that goes beyond traditional treatments.     Hair Cloning vs. Hair Multiplication While the terms are frequently used interchangeably, it is critical to understand the subtle distinction between genuine hair cloning and the complex process of hair multiplication. Hair cloning begins with the extraction of a single hair follicle, which is then followed by in vitro cloning aided by growth conditions to induce robust multiplication. Hair multiplication, on the other hand, requires extracting a hair follicle, dividing it into many pieces, and transplanting it into regions where hair is thinning. The underlying hope stems from the possibility that germinative stem cells near the hair's root, which were saved during removal, may help in the formation of new follicles. Explore the complexities of various hair restoration treatments and their different methodologies, diving into the exciting domain of hair cloning and multiplication for a thorough grasp of sophisticated remedies. Challenges with Hair Cloning and Multiplication The path to commercializing hair follicle cloning and multiplication technologies has been fraught with difficulties. These difficulties are mostly due to the delicate intricacy and delicacy of hair follicles. Traditional cloning researchers have the issue of creating an ideal environment that promotes cell proliferation while maintaining a hair-like condition. The difficulty comes from keeping the precise balance essential for effective cloning. Hair multiplication, on the other hand, provides its own set of challenges. Researchers revealed that each retrieved hair produces a small number of germinative cells, and only a small percentage of these cells survive the re-implantation procedure into the scalp. This drastically reduces the possibility of these cells subsequently producing new hair follicles. Finasteride Finasteride, an oral medicine authorized by the FDA, is a commonly recommended therapy for male pattern baldness. It works by preventing the formation of dihydrotestosterone (DHT), a hormone associated to hair loss. Finasteride has been shown to be beneficial in decreasing hair loss and promoting hair regeneration in a variety of people.
